Tartiflett

5 servings

40 minutes

Tartiflette is a hearty dish from French cuisine, originating from the Savoy region known for its cheese traditions. Its history is closely linked to reblochon cheese, which gives the dish a unique creamy flavor. Tender slices of potato are infused with the aroma of sautéed onions and bacon, creating an appetizing combination of textures. Baked in the oven, the mixture of cream and cheese forms a golden crust, making each bite delightfully gooey and rich. Tartiflette is perfect as a winter dish that warms you in cold weather and pairs wonderfully with a glass of white wine. It is served as a main course or side dish to meat and becomes a symbol of gastronomic pleasure in cozy company.

Ingredients
5servings
Potato
1 
kg
Onion
1 
pc
Bacon
100 
g
Hard cheese
250 
g
Cream
150 
ml
Cooking steps
  • 1

    Boil the sliced potatoes for 10 minutes

    Required ingredients:
    1. Potato1 kg
  • 2

    Fry onion with bacon

    Required ingredients:
    1. Onion1 piece
    2. Bacon100 g
  • 3

    Cut the cheese into slices

    Required ingredients:
    1. Hard cheese250 g
  • 4

    Place the potatoes on a baking sheet, top with onions and bacon, and pour cream over it.

    Required ingredients:
    1. Potato1 kg
    2. Onion1 piece
    3. Bacon100 g
    4. Cream150 ml
  • 5

    Bake for 20 minutes in the oven at medium temperature
